Do dreams of playing Quidditch, boarding the train at Platform 9-3/4 for a visit to Hogwarts and meeting Harry, Hermione, Granger and Ron Weasley keep your student’s imagination spinning? Perhaps the would-be-sorcerer sharing your home has even been inspired by J.K. Rowling’s books to try his or her hand at writing. If so, here’s an opportunity you won’t want to miss.

On Saturday, Nov. 29, local authors and members of the California Writers Club will be at the Pleasant Hill Barnes & Noble bookstore (552 Contra Costa Blvd.) from 11 a.m. until 6 p.m. to talk to Contra Costa County middle school students about the group’s annual Young Writers Contest and FREE writing workshops. Special guest Harry Potter will also be on hand.

Students from all over the county have participated in this contest and workshops each year, inspiring them to write. Besides earning an opportunity to chat with published writers, many students come away with prizes, kudos and a possible head start to a future as a writer.

Need another incentive? How about cash? Twenty-seven sixth-, seventh-and eighth-grade winners will share $1,575 in prize money and attend a banquet where they hobnob with authors of many genres. Need a bigger nudge? Maybe free chocolate rings your chimes.

Present a sample voucher you’ll receive from the authors, and Barnes & Noble will donate a percentage of your purchase to help support the Young Writers Contest.

Oh, yes: and about Harry Potter. Look for him in the Target/Toys R Us parking lot. He’ll be the one with the Hogwarts robe and a menacing cloud of helium balloons. One of those balloons (while supplies last) will contain a $20 gift card redeemable at Barnes & Noble.
